LUDINGTON — Ludington City Councilor Cheri Stibitz and Carol Hoekstra advanced to the Nov. 3 general election Tuesday after finishing as the top two vote-getters in the city’s three-way mayoral primary, according to unofficial results.
Stibitz led the field with 823 votes, while Hoekstra received 507 votes. Beth Elliott finished third with 479 votes and was eliminated from the race.
The primary reduced the field from three candidates to two, with the top two finishers earning spots on the November ballot.
Unofficial citywide totals were:
- Cheri Stibitz: 823
- Carol Hoekstra: 507
- Beth Elliott: 479
Stibitz carried each of the city’s six precincts, receiving 189 votes in Precinct 1, 151 in Precinct 2, 169 in Precinct 3, 100 in Precinct 4, 115 in Precinct 5 and 99 in Precinct 6. Hoekstra finished second overall, although Elliott narrowly outpolled her in Precinct 6 by a 95-74 margin.
Stibitz and Hoekstra will face each other in the Nov. 3 general election to determine Ludington’s next mayor.
